Problem

Transparent display panels face challenges in maintaining transparency due to reflection of external environment light by light emitting and driving devices, which affects display effect, and the use of polarizers to mitigate this reduces light transmissivity.

Innovation Solution

A display panel with a polarization layer that absorbs external environment light in the display region while transmitting it in the transparent region, utilizing a guest-host liquid crystal layer and phase difference film modules to control light absorptivity and transmissivity, respectively.

Solution Approach 1:

The display panel is divided into two distinct regions: a display region and a transparent region. The polarization layer is selectively applied only to the display region, while the transparent region remains free of the polarization layer. This segmentation allows the polarizer to absorb external environment light in the display region without affecting light transmissivity in the transparent region, thus resolving the contradiction between reducing reflection and maintaining transparency.

PatentUS11119354B2Display panel, method for manufacturing the same and display device
Publication Date: 2021.09.14 CHENGDU BOE OPTOELECTRONICS TECH CO LTD

The present disclosure provides a display panel, a method for manufacturing the same and a display device. The display panel includes a substrate and a plurality of pixels provided on the substrate, each of the pixels includes a display region and a transparent region, a light emitting device is provided in the display region, the display panel further includes a polarization layer provided in the display region and the transparent region, and at a light exiting side of the light emitting device departing from the substrate, a portion of the polarization layer located in the display region is configured to absorb external environment light, and another portion of the polarization layer located in the transparent region is configured to transmit the external environment light.
